| 背面描述 | A three-quarter facing portrait of Lokmata Devi Ahilyabai Holkar occupies the central field, depicted in traditional attire with a draped sari and dupatta covering her head, wearing a pearl necklace, rendered in a fine engraved illustrative style. The Devanagari legend 'अहिल्याबाई होलकर की 300वीं जयंती' curves along the upper periphery. The dates '1725' and '2025' appear in the left and right fields respectively, flanking the portrait. The Latin legend '300TH BIRTH ANNIVERSARY OF AHILYABAI HOLKAR' is inscribed along the lower arc of the coin. |

Ahilyabai Holkar ruled Malwa as de facto head of the Holkar state from 1767 until her death in 1795, administering from Maheshwar rather than Indore and funding temple construction and infrastructure across the subcontinent at a scale that drew praise from contemporaries including Mountstuart Elphinstone. The 300-rupee face value places this squarely in India's commemorative collector series — a denomination that exists purely as a vehicle for bullion issues and carries no circulation intent. The .500 fineness is lower than most sovereign commemoratives from comparable programs, yielding roughly 17.5 grams of actual silver content.
